Big Charlie Black depicts a large hog with an itch behind its ear. Unfortunately, the hog is too fat to itch it. The sculpture was created by Carrie Gantt Quade in Hockessin, Delaware. It was then purchased by Barrette Family Fund, a fund within the New Hampshire Charitable Foundation, and donated to Mesa's Permanent Sculpture Collection in 2006.
Big Charlie Black now sits on the Southwest corner of Main St. and MacDonald St. in downtown Mesa, AZ.
